Dear FMLer's
 
As of 8:00PM August 24, 1998, Ferret Friends Disaster Response International
(FFDRI) went from Disaster Watch status to Disaster Alert Status for the
following:
 
Southern Texas Del Rio area - Disaster Alert (MASSIVE FLOODING)
 
Savannah GA to boarder of VA - Disaster Alert (Hurricane Bonnie)
 
It is advised that all Children of fur, feathers, scales, shells and hooves
parents as well as the shelters in the Eastern Seaboard of the United States
visit the FFDRI web Site at
http://www.worldaccessnet.com/~ferretma/ffdri1.html
Print up the Disaster Manual and fill out the forms now.  Also there are
links in our site that can assist you in receiving other disaster
preparedness and response information.
 
To remind everyone -- should the FFDRI change status from "Disaster Alert"
to "Disaster Response" the E-mail address will change to [log in to unmask] -
all messages from this address should be taken seriously and responded to
As soon as possible.
